The government's home battery rebate program has been a massive success. Over 160,000 Australian households have already installed batteries with support from the scheme, with most of those installations happening in suburbs and regional areas.That's great news for the energy transition. But it's created a timing issue. Here's what's changing and what it means if you're planning to get a battery.

Daytime energy prices are dropping to zero or even going negative as Australia's solar systems pump out more energy than the grid needs. For Amber customers with batteries or EVs, these are golden opportunities to charge up for free (or get paid to do it). But if you charge everything at once at full speed, you might overload your home and lose power. The good news? A few simple tweaks to your charging settings mean you can safely soak up all that cheap energy without any drama.
